Choosing the right foundation shade is essential for achieving a flawless makeup look. The first step in this process is to determine your skin undertone. There are three main undertones: cool, warm, and neutral. To find yours, look at the veins on your wrist: blue or purple veins indicate a cool undertone, green or olive veins suggest a warm undertone, and a mix of both can point to a neutral undertone. Once you know your undertone, select foundations that are specifically labeled for your skin type to ensure a better match.
Next, it's crucial to test the foundations before making a purchase. Start by applying a small amount of foundation on your jawline and blend it in. Make sure to check the color in natural lighting to see how it interacts with your skin tone. If the shade disappears into your skin, you've likely found your perfect match. Consider trying two to three shades to see which one complements your skin the best. Remember, the right foundation shade should look seamless and enhance your natural beauty, rather than mask it.
Many makeup enthusiasts may not realize that their favorite products have an expiration date that can significantly impact skin health and overall appearance. Unlike food items, makeup expiration dates are not always printed prominently on the packaging, which leaves many users in the dark about when it’s time to toss their cosmetics. The general rule of thumb is that liquid foundations and concealers last about 12 months, while powder products can often last between 2 to 3 years. Always check for any changes in texture, color, or smell, as these can be telltale signs that it’s time for a replacement.
To effectively track the lifespan of your makeup, consider implementing a simple labeling system. By marking the purchase date on each product or maintaining a makeup inventory list, you can easily monitor when it’s time to discard items. Additionally, pay attention to the PAO (Period After Opening) symbol, usually found on the packaging, which indicates how long a product is considered safe for use after being opened. Being proactive about checking your makeup's expiration date not only ensures you are using safe products but also enhances the effectiveness of your beauty routine.
